I am learning about blockchains.

I tried running a light version Ethereum node on ubuntu geth console (for study purposes).

I was wondering if it is possible to run a light version Tron node. If so, how can I do it? If not, is there a way for me to connect to online public Tron nodes?

I looked up Tron documentation but realized they were not as thorough as Ethereum documentation. I am kinda stuck. There do mention about Lite FullNode tron node. However, I have to first sync full node to make it Lite FullNode (?). However, I don't have enough storage for that, not to mention RAM requirement.

I'd be glad if you provide an answer/insight. Thanks
